How to Import a Twitter Search Into FriendFeed

FriendFeed is a social network that aggregates your updates across multiple other social media sites, ranging from your latest tweet to the film you just added to your Netflix queue. This lets friends read and comment on your activities in one central location. In addition to or in place of connecting your Twitter account to FriendFeed, you can also add a Twitter search feed to post mentions of your name, your company name or any other search string of your choice to your FriendFeed profile.

Instructions

    • 1

      Enter your search term or phrase into the Twitter search engine at search.twitter.com.

    • 2

      Click "Feed for This Query" on the right.

    • 3

      Highlight the feed address in your Web browser's address bar. Press "Ctrl" and "C" to copy this URL.

    • 4

      Log into your FriendFeed account at friendfeed.com.

    • 5

      Click "Settings" on the right.

    • 6

      Click "add/edit" next to Services.

    • 7

      Click "Blog" under Blogging.

    • 8

      Click inside the "Blog URL" box. Press "Ctrl" and "V" to paste the Twitter search feed URL.

    • 9

      Click "Import Blog." The most recent search results now appear in your FriendFeed profile, and new results will post to your profile regularly.
